You think the best part of a Fair is the food on the midway? Well, the good news is you not only get Carnival food at Frontier Days, there's so much more! Eat free pancakes and get access to barbecue and so much more. Pancake Breakfasts: Enjoy a free breakfast with visitors from all over the world! Volunteers will serve up more than 100,000 flapjacks, cook 3,000 pounds of ham, serve 9,200 cartons of milk and 520 gallons of coffee, along with 630 pounds of butter and 475 gallons of syrup! Monday, Wednesday, and Friday from 7-9am. And local churches also hold lunches after the Pancake Breakfasts (signs are up downtown to lead you to the vittles!). at their lodge at the corner of 19th and Capitol on parade mornings. Night Shows Besides the PRCA event, which is called The Daddy of 'em All because of the prizes, you can catch the finals of the Championship Bull Riding season, as they crown their champions. The event draws top professionals cowboys, competing for more than $1 million in cash and prizes. RodeosĬheyenne celebrates its Authentic West roots each year with the world's largest outdoor rodeo.

In fact, named Cheyenne Frontier Days as the top festival in the nation in their annual Top 10 Summer Festivals.Ĭheyenne Frontier Days includes PRCA rodeo & slack events, concerts, Professional Bull Riders, USAF Thunderbirds, parades, pancake breakfasts, Western Art Show & sale, carnival, Old West Museum, and an Indian Village. The first Frontier Days was held as a cowboy roundup that featured bronco busting and steer roping contests as well as pony races.ġ26 years later, Cheyenne Frontier Days is a 10-day festival of rip-roarin' excitement, featuring the world's best PRCA rodeo action and Western entertainment. The Daddy of 'em All has been kicking up dust since 1897 with the world's largest outdoor rodeo and Western Celebration.
